Description
Rich and fudgy brownies that are quick to make and perfect for any occasion.
Ingredients
- 1/2 cup oil or 1 stick (1/2 cup) melted butter
- 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1 cup sugar
- 2 eggs
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 1/2 cup chocolate chips
- 1/2 cup chopped walnuts (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a small baking pan (8×8). Line with parchment for easy removal.
- In a mixing bowl, combine oil or melted butter, cocoa powder, and sugar. Mix until smooth.
- Add eggs and vanilla extract, mixing until combined.
- Add flour and salt, mixing gently to combine without overworking the batter.
- Fold in chocolate chips and walnuts if using. Spread batter in the prepared pan and smooth the top.
- Bake for 18-20 minutes until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
- Let cool in the pan on a wire rack for at least 20 minutes. Cut into squares and serve warm or at room temperature.
Notes
For a fudgier brownie, reduce flour to 3/8 cup. Store in an airtight container for up to three days.
